Bjørnar Berg is a scholar working on Surgery, Biomedical Engineering and Pharmacology. According to data from OpenAlex, Bjørnar Berg has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 221 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Surgery, 6 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 5 papers in Pharmacology. Recurrent topics in Bjørnar Berg’s work include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(11 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(9 papers) and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(5 papers). Bjørnar Berg is often cited by papers focused on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(11 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(9 papers) and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(5 papers). Bjørnar Berg collaborates with scholars based in Norway, Denmark and Australia. Bjørnar Berg's co-authors include Adam G. Culvenor, Carsten Bogh Juhl, Britt Elin Øiestad, Jonas Bloch Thorlund, M.I. Abdullah, May Arna Risberg, Ewa M. Roos, Inger Holm, Kay M. Crossley and Jackie L. Whittaker and has published in prestigious journals such as Water Research, The American Journal of Sports Medicine and Computers & Education.
